技术文摘
Silverlight程序集引用问题答疑
Silverlight程序集引用问题答疑
在Silverlight开发过程中,程序集引用问题常常让开发者感到困扰。本文将针对一些常见的程序集引用问题进行答疑,帮助大家更好地理解和解决相关难题。
什么是程序集引用?简单来说,程序集引用就是在一个项目中使用其他程序集(包含代码和资源的文件)的功能。在Silverlight中,正确引用程序集是确保应用程序正常运行的关键。
一个常见的问题是找不到程序集。这可能是由于程序集的路径设置不正确导致的。在引用程序集时,要确保路径准确无误,包括相对路径和绝对路径的设置。如果是从外部引入的程序集,需要检查其是否已正确添加到项目的引用列表中。
另一个问题是版本不兼容。不同版本的程序集可能存在接口、方法等方面的差异。当引用的程序集版本与项目要求不匹配时,就会出现各种错误。在引用程序集之前,务必确认其版本与项目的兼容性,尽量使用匹配的版本。
还有可能遇到命名空间冲突的问题。当多个程序集中存在相同的命名空间时,编译器可能会混淆。解决方法是通过使用别名来区分不同的命名空间,或者对引用的程序集进行适当的修改,避免命名空间的重复。
在实际开发中,有时候即使程序集引用看似正确,但在运行时仍然会出现问题。这可能是因为程序集的依赖关系没有处理好。某些程序集可能依赖于其他程序集才能正常运行,所以在引用时需要确保所有的依赖项都已正确添加。
在更新程序集时也要格外小心。更新后可能会引入新的问题,需要重新检查引用是否仍然有效,以及是否有新的兼容性问题。
Silverlight程序集引用问题需要我们仔细检查和分析。从路径设置、版本兼容性到命名空间和依赖关系,每个环节都可能影响程序的正常运行。只有对这些问题有清晰的认识,并采取正确的解决方法,才能确保Silverlight应用程序的稳定和高效运行。
TAGS: Silverlight 问题答疑 程序集引用 Silverlight程序集
- Git merge 与 Git rebase 的选择之道
- 面试官:@Transactional 和 @Async 能否同时运用
- C#中简单工厂模式的实现
- 深度选择器解析:/deep/、>>>、::v-deep 与 v-deep() 的差异及用法
- 十个可靠的 Html 端视频播放器 JavaScript 库
- 11 个 Web 高级工程师必备的 Web API
- 百度一面:SpringBoot 优雅停机之法
- 面试官:如何排查网页过慢问题?
- Next.js 15 重磅发布:七大变革性更新,前端性能再度提升
- Set 获史诗级强化 新增七种实用方法!
- C# 开发之轻松监控方法执行耗时技巧
- 我编写 MD 引擎助力用户一键迁移 MD 至 Nocode/WEP 知识库
- 五种编写“自然”代码的妙法,令人爱不释手
- 璀璨星河因你璀璨 鸿蒙系列沙龙报名正火热开展!
- 列表的创建、销毁及缓存池的解析